In a competitive examination containing 200 questions, 2
marks are awarded for every correct answer and 1 mark gets deducted for every wrong answer. If a student attempted all questions and obtained 97 marks, how many wrong answers must he have given?Solution
Let number of questions with right answers = x ∴ No. of questions with wrong answers = 200 – x ∴ Marks obtained for right answers = 2x ∴ Marks deducted for wrong answers = 200 – x ∴ 2x - (200 – x) = 97⇒ 3x = 200 + 97 ⇒ 3x = 297 ∴ x = 99 ∴ No. of questions with wrong answers (200 – 99) = 101
